5. Big Bob Gibson Bar-B-Q

No culinary journey through Decatur is complete without a stop at Big Bob Gibson Bar-B-Q. Sink your teeth into succulent smoked meats and tangy homemade sauces that have made this place a Southern barbecue legend. This award-winning BBQ is sure to please any foodie who stops by. Make sure to try their delicious pies and take home some of their original Alabama White Sauce when you leave. This Decatur staple also has two locations, one located on 6th Ave, and the other on Danville Rd.

6. Simp McGhee's

Step back in time at Simp McGhee's, where Southern hospitality meets modern flavors. From crispy fried green tomatoes to rich shrimp and grits, this eatery captures the essence of Decatur's culinary heritage. Named after the historic steamboat Captain Simp McGhee, this restaurant offers an upscale cajun flavor to Downtown Decatur.

9. B.B Perrins

Prepare to be wowed at B.B. Perrins – not just your average BBQ joint, but a lively sports bar adorned with Decatur and Alabama sports memorabilia. This unique gem adds a dash of local pride to the Alabama Restaurant Week lineup, promising both mouthwatering BBQ and a side of sports nostalgia!
